The value of x = 135 degrees.

You can figure this out easily by extending the top and bottom sides of the trapezoid, and finding supplementary / corresponding angles.

First, look at the top. We know that supplementary angles add up to 180 degrees (or form a straight line), so subtract 180 - 45 to get 135 degrees.

When you extend the short (bottom) side of the trapezoid along with the long (top) side and the diagonal line, it’s easy to see that there are corresponding angles. The 135-degree angle corresponds with angle x, so the measure of x would therefore be 135 degrees.
